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ak on tile floor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ained water damage.
Flooded basement with standing water No Yes Standing water needs professional extraction and drying to prevent mold growth and structural damage.
Wet drywall behind cabinets No Yes Water damage behind walls needs professional inspection and remediation to prevent further damage and health risks.
Storm damage to roof and exterior walls No Yes Storm damage to the exterior of your property needs professional inspection and repair to prevent further damage and safety risks.
Minor mold growth in bathroom No Yes Mold growth needs professional inspection and remediation to prevent further damage and health risks.
Large-scale storm damage to entire property No Yes Large-scale storm damage needs professional assessment and repair to restore your property to its original condition.

With storm damage restoration, professional help is often the best choice – especially with large-scale damage or complex restoration projects. Storm Damage Restoration Cost in the 2702 Area

The cost of storm damage restoration in the 2702 area can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should give you a general idea of what to expect. Keep in mind that ex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age, and local labor costs.
Structural Drying Process $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age, and local labor costs.
Mold Inspection and Testing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, and local testing costs.
Basement Flood Recovery $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age, and local labor costs.
Sewage Cleanup $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, severity of sewage damage, and local labor costs.
Storm Damage Restoration $3,000 – $15,000 Size of affected area, severity of storm damage, and local labor costs.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ers. We’ll work with you to develop a plan that meets your needs and budget, and we’ll be with you every step of the way to ensure a smooth and successful restoration process.
